Stella Ethel
Shaffer
Aug 23, 1933 — Jun 2, 2025
Stella Ethel Shaffer, 91, of rural Columbia City, passed away at 7:40 a.m. on Monday, June 2, 2025, at StoryPoint in Fort Wayne, where she had been a resident since 2017.
Born on August 23, 1933, in Whitley County, Indiana, she was a daughter of the late Lee and Eva (Snepp) Walker. Growing up near Coesse, where she started school, the family then moved to Washington Twp., where she completed her formal education at Washington Center School.
On November 11, 1950, she married Joseph D. Shaffer. They made their home on a farm in Jefferson Twp., raising four daughters. After 61 years of marriage, Joseph died on February 11, 2012.
A farm wife, she maintained the household and assisted on the farm. She is remembered as a great cook with her signature soup recipes. An accomplished seamstress, she made clothes and often altered pre-made clothing to fit her exact standards. In her senior year, she liked to read romance novels and watch the evening game shows on TV.
She is survived by her daughters, Penny Shaffer of Indianapolis, Pamela (Carl) Emley of Roanoke, Paula (Ellis) Sturgill of Huntington, and Polly (David) Cox of Tomball, TX; five granddaughters, one grandson and three great-great-grandchildren.
Additionally, she was preceded in death by a granddaughter, Autumn; sisters, Edna DePoy, Gladys Gamble, and Grace Scott. and a brother, Lee Walker
The funeral service is at noon on Saturday (June 7th) at Smith & Sons Funeral Home, Columbia City. Burial is beside her husband at the South Whitley Cemetery. Visitation is from 10 a.m. until the funeral service Saturday at the funeral home.
Memorials in Stella's honor are to the Humane Society of Whitley County.
